MONTREAL — Quincaillerie Richelieu saw sales increase by 15.5% in the second quarter, reaching $190.8 million. The bulk of the growth was internal to the company, but it was also bosted by acquisitions. Last month, Richelieu acquired Single Source Cabinet Supplies, a speciality hardware retailer in Dallas. The acquisition gives Richelieu strategic access to the lucrative Texas market. Sales to manufacturers increased 14.3% during the period. The company bought back 143,000 shares totalling $8.7 million.
